Building on the earlier suggestion, that $359 price point for a July release puts the 5900XT in a weird spot. Since its actually a 16-core part, you really need to be careful about what youre actually paying for vs the older flagships.

  • AMD Ryzen 9 5900XT 16-Core 3.3GHz: Pros include the 16 cores for multitasking, but the lower base clock compared to the 5950X is a bit of a letdown.
  • AMD Ryzen 9 5950X 16-Core 3.4GHz: I would suggest hunting for a discounted 5950X. Its essentially the same chip but usually hits higher boosts.
  • AMD Ryzen 7 5800X3D 8-Core 3.4GHz: For pure gaming, dont even look at the 5900XT. This is still the better buy for pure frame rates. Make sure your motherboard has a BIOS update ready before you buy... honestly, I have seen too many people get stuck with no-post because they forgot to flash the firmware for these XT refreshes. Check your VRM cooling too.

Ryzen 9 5900XT will retail at $359, while the 5800XT will cost $249. Both processors are said to launch in July.
